New boys shine in vital win

Romford (1) 3, Halstead Town (1) 2 – Saturday 14th March 2026 – Essex Senior League

For the first time this season, Boro won a league game after trailing and picked up three vital points in the fight against relegation in the process.

Romford had two players making their debuts – goalkeeper Lee Haylock and forward Tayo Oyebola – while Matt Price, Jake Barlow, and Darnell Fuller were all making only their second starts, and they all played their part in Boro’s win which, with all bar one of the other sides in the bottom half losing, creates a five point cushion above the drop zone.

Boro set about the visitors with purpose from the off and in the opening minute Darnell Fuller - who took the Man of The Match award from match sponsors, The Frostys – went close with a low shot before Matt Price and Halstead keeper Jack Cherry tangled with Boro hoping for a penalty only for the foul to go the other way.

Halstead’s Kane Gilbert chipped the ball onto the roof of the Boro net and then Fuller latched onto Flynn Hamilton’s header, cut inside and drew a diving save from Cherry as the sides exchanged chances. Lee Haylock then had to be alert to save a low shot from Gilbert, but back came Boro and Greig Stewart had a shot deflected over from a short corner routine, and from the ensuing corner, Nick Reynolds’ shot went over the bar.

It was somewhat against the run of play that Halstead scored after 25 minutes. Billy Jamison got on the end of a long throw and although Haylock saved his effort with his legs, the ball fell kindly to Kane Gilbert, who followed up to score. Haylock then had to stretch to turn away a low shot after 36 minutes with Halstead’s follow up from the loose ball cleared for a corner.

Haylock set up Boro’s equaliser in the 39th minute. His long, accurate clearance allowed Darnell Fuller a run at the Halstead defence, and when his low cross was pushed out by Cherry, Matt Price was beaten to the ball by Halstead's Kane Gilbert who diverted it into his own net. Boro then had chances to go in front; Fuller set up Price who scuffed his shot wide and then Fuller again showed his pace to get himself into a shooting position, but his effort was blocked.

The second half opened with Flynn Hamilton’s free-kick held by Cherry just under his crossbar, and then Boro had two efforts blocked following a corner before going ahead with a goal on the hour. Tayo Oyebola, on the right flank, played the ball inside to Hamilton, ran onto the return pass and lifted the ball over the advancing Cherry. Five minutes later, Darnell Fuller extended Boro’s lead with a similar goal. Outpacing the Halstead defence, Fuller took Teddy Desmond’s pass in his stride and finished adroitly.

Halstead now began to put pressure on the Boro defence as they sought to get back in the match. Their best chance came when Haylock had to make an important diving save to push away a header from Elias Ahmed.

As the game entered added time, Romford went close to a fourth. Matt Price spotted Cherry slightly off his line and tried his luck from the halfway line, but the backpedalling Halstead keeper managed to tip the ball over the bar. Romford wasted the corner and Halstead moved forward with purpose, cutting Boro’s lead through Harry Pinkney’s shot from outside the penalty area five minutes into stoppage time. They then almost spoiled Boro’s afternoon when Jamie Bennett attempted to catch Haylock off his line with a speculative effort, but fortunately the Boro keeper was able to get back to save.

Boro are not out of the woods yet, but this crucial win means that for the moment, their fate is in their own hands.

Romford: Lee Haylock, Joe Damrell (Munir Hadi 78'), Teddy Desmond, Louis Mathias, Jake Barlow, Nick Reynolds, Tayo Oyebola (Henry Hart 78'), Greig Stewart, Matthew Price, Flynn Hamilton, Darnell Fuller Unused subs: Harry Elsey, Freddy Cooper, Christian Adu Gyamfi

Report: Mike Woods
